Subject: Pickwise cut-over complete

Hi all — quick summary for those joining this week. The Pickwise pick-list optimizer is now serving all zones at the Harwick distribution center; the legacy batcher was retired Saturday night. Pick times dropped roughly 11% in the first two shifts and no rollbacks were needed. Route scoring and wave sizing behave slightly differently than the old tool, so review the docs. The production service currently runs with these configuration values.

config for kajog-tadug:
[casax]
port = 11211
region = west-3
host = casax.nelvroworks.internal
timeout_ms = 5000
retries = 7

Subject: Key rotation — Stormpetal alert fan-out

Hello,

We rotated the service key for the Stormpetal weather-alert fan-out this morning. Alerts will fail to publish with the old key after Thursday. Update your worker config and redeploy; endpoints and quotas are unchanged. Let the platform team know if test alerts bounce. The new key follows below.

service key, yahog-hahif: vxb4-ywz4

- [ ] Step 7: Archive cold storage buckets (Glacierline tier). Confirm both ceremony witnesses are present, verify bucket manifests match the Oxbow ledger, then seal the archive key shares. Plugin authors may observe but not handle shares. Once sealed, the archive index itself is encrypted and can only be reopened with the passphrase below.

vault phrase of badup-hahig = tamael-aldael-kelmir-istael-fenok-istwyn-tamius-jorath-oliion